Subject: Quickstore 4.2 — bloom filter now fronts the KV layer

Plugin authors: starting with this release, Quickstore places a bloom filter ahead of the key-value store. Negative lookups return faster; false positives fall through safely. No API changes are required on your side. Verify your plugin against the staging build referenced below.

session token of fahif-tadup = htk3_9c7

### Changed defaults — EXIF scrubbing

Heads up for the 4.2 release: Pictoria now strips EXIF metadata on upload by default instead of opt-in. GPS tags, camera serials, the lot — gone unless a workspace explicitly re-enables them. Release notes should flag this loudly. The new default configuration shipping with 4.2 is below.

deployment values, yadup-kadug:
[sorys]
port = 5672
team = noveth
host = sorys.orvexcorp.example
region = south-4
access_code = ac_deddc1
timeout_ms = 1500

// On-call note for the Bannergate consent rollout:
// We're ramping the new consent banner to 25% of Driftwell traffic
// tonight. If the opt-out rate spikes above 8%, flip the killswitch
// in Togglepost and page whoever owns region routing. The client
// below reports consent events to the internal Ledgerbloom service,
// and yes, it still wants a raw key instead of the vault path —
// that migration is next sprint, sorry. Put the Ledgerbloom service
// key on the line right after this comment.

app token of kajop-tahag = qvz23-qaEp6MzrfP2AwhVbZwsZeUq

## Test plan: incremental rebuilds

Plugin authors verifying compatibility with the Larkspindle incremental build engine should cover three cases: a single changed page, a changed shared layout, and a deleted route. Confirm that only affected pages are regenerated and that the manifest diff matches expectations. Full rebuilds triggered by config changes are out of scope for this pass. Run the suite against the hosted preview environment, which accepts builds authenticated with the token printed below.

session JWT of yawep-yawep = eyJhbGciOiJIUzI1NiIsInR5cCI6IkpXVCJ9.eyJzdWIiOiI3pWF3_In0.aXYsHiog